CVSEEME is the UK’s first dedicated graduate recruitment website exclusive for university students and recent graduates that incorporates online web 2.0 video technology.

As such, we wanted to put together a team of students and graduates from across the country to act as a ‘Group Student Voice’ on behalf of not only their own University but also their region and across the UK in general. Whether it be for writing general topical news stories or becoming an official Columnist/Journalist on behalf of CVSEEME; we invite you to have a voice of opinion. You can send in to us news articles, write stories, interview other graduate job seekers by video and send these in.

The National Student Council is a virtual board of students and graduates founded by Keith our CEO to offer a centralized place to view real and personal insights into how others are feeling in the graduate job climate and what they’re doing to find a job. A kind of 'help me, help you' community.

With the fact that ‘COMMUNICATION & INTERPERSONAL SKILLS’ has been voted the most important factor in all recruitment – and especially graduate recruitment – we’re very passionate about our Council as clearly, it is impossible to derive such skills from a paper CV alone. This is where CVSEEME can play a real part in assisting graduate job seekers.
